4.3  
STATUS Register  
This register contains the arithmetic status of the ALU,  
the RESET status, and the page preselect bits for  
program memories larger than 512 words.  
It is recommended, therefore, that only BCF, BSF and  
MOVWF instructions be used to alter the STATUS  
register because these instructions do not affect the Z,  
DC or C bits from the STATUS register. For other  
instructions, which do affect STATUS bits, see  
Section 8.0, Instruction Set Summary.  
The STATUS register can be the destination for any  
instruction, as with any other register. If the STATUS  
register is the destination for an instruction that affects  
the Z, DC or C bits, then the write to these three bits is  
disabled. These bits are set or cleared according to  
the device logic. Furthermore, the TO and PD bits are  
not writable. Therefore, the result of an instruction with  
the STATUS register as destination may be different  
than intended.

bit 7:  
PA2: This bit unused at this time.  
Use of the PA2 bit as a general purpose read/write bit is not recommended, since this may affect upward  
compatibility with future products.  
bit 6-5: Not Applicable  
bit 4:  
bit 3:  
bit 2:  
bit 1:  
TO: Time-out bit  
1 = After power-up, CLRWDTinstruction, or SLEEPinstruction  
0 = A WDT time-out occurred  
PD: Power-down bit  
1 = After power-up or by the CLRWDTinstruction  
0 = By execution of the SLEEPinstruction  
Z: Zero bit  
1 = The result of an arithmetic or logic operation is zero  
0 = The result of an arithmetic or logic operation is not zero  
DC: Digit carry/borrow bit (for ADDWFand SUBWFinstructions)  
ADDWF  
1 = A carry from the 4th low order bit of the result occurred  
0 = A carry from the 4th low order bit of the result did not occur  
SUBWF  
1 = A borrow from the 4th low order bit of the result did not occur  
0 = A borrow from the 4th low order bit of the result occurred
